NATO commences first multinational naval exercise of 2021 in Black Sea

The North Atlantic Treaty Organization has launched the first multinational naval exercise of 2021 in the Black Sea.

Reports say the exercises have been organised by the Romanian Naval Forces (FNR) and will include the participation of the FNR along with forces from Bulgaria, France, Greece, Spain, the US, and Turkey.

Poseidon 21 is part of NATO's Program of Combined Joint Enhanced Training to enhance security on its south-eastern European flank and ensure a continued presence in the region.

Today's exercises come after last month's USS Porter's movement, a guided-missile destroyer, to join the USS Donald Cook and a refueling ship, the USNS Laramie, in the largest deployment of US naval forces to the Black Sea since 2017.
